Summary

Amends the:

Australian Crime Commission Act 2002
to facilitate the transition from the National Crime Authority to the Australian Crime Commission (ACC) by addressing transitional and other issues which have arisen since the establishment of the ACC on 1 January 2003;
Administrative Decisions (Judicial Review) Act 1977
to exempt certain decisions from being subject to requests for statements of reasons; and
Australian Postal Corporation Act 1989
to allow disclosure of certain information and documents to the ACC.
